On Saturday, April 12, former Port Of Los Angeles High School standout Mikalah Nitta’s current college team, the Houston Cougars, lost 6-2 in their NCAA Division I softball game against the Texas Tech Lady Raiders.

The game took place at Rocky Johnson Field. This was their second matchup against the Lady Raiders this season.

The Cougars’ next game is scheduled for Sunday, April 13 at 12 p.m. at Rocky Johnson Field against Texas Tech Lady Raiders.
